We are pleased to announce the upcoming International Youth Scientific and Practical Conference, dedicated to the Day of Science Workers of the Republic of Kazakhstan. The conference will take place on April 9–10, 2026, and will serve as a large-scale platform for discussing pressing issues related to decarbonization, green energy, and the future development of oil and natural gas. 
The event will bring together undergraduate and graduate students, young scientists, researchers, and industry representatives from Kazakhstan and abroad. The conference aims to foster a new generation of professional scientific community capable of addressing modern technological and environmental challenges. 
 
Primary objectives of conference:  
To create a platform for active dialogue and exchange of scientific research; 
To support the academic and intellectual development of young specialists; 
To strengthen collaboration between researchers and industry professionals. 
 
Conference Theme: 
The conference focuses on current issues such as the future of the oil and gas industry, decarbonization, and green energy. In line with the expansion of academic programs at the School of Energy and Petroleum Industry and the development of priority areas of study, a new thematic section has been added to the conference program to address emerging industry challenges. 
 
Conference Sections:  


1. Modern drilling technologies and methods; 
2. Cutting-edge technologies for the extraction for hard-to-recovery oil reserves. Energy Transition: The Role of Uranium and Nuclear Power in the Future Energy balance; 
3. Sustainable Growth of Offshore Oil and Gas Projects through the Development of Transportation Systems and Marine Services. Offshore Projects and Transport Logistics: Innovations for Sustainable Growth and Marine Logistics in the Oil and Gas Industry; 
4. Digital twins of oil and gas fields (reservoir simulation). Digital technologies, industry 4.0, and artificial intelligent; 
5. Innovative Technologies for Oil and Gas Transportation: Enhancing the Reliability of Pipeline Systems; 
6. Modern Methods of Geological Research; 
7. Petrochemical Technologies, Catalysis and Advanced Materials for Sustainable Energy; 
8. Functional Materials for Sustainable Development;
